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Hodges, is another tropical month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 69.1°F (20.6°C) and 88.5°F (31.4°C).

Temperature

Hodges's transition from July to August introduces an average high-temperature of a still tropical 88.5°F (31.4°C), marking an insignificant variation from the 89.2°F (31.8°C). During August, Hodges experiences a consistent low-temperature average of 69.1°F (20.6°C).

Heat index

The heat index value during August is appraised at a blisteringly hot 104°F (40°C). Implement more safety precautions, heat cramps and heat exhaustion may happen. Persistent activity could induce heatstroke.
In terms of the heat index, values are set with light wind and shade conditions in mind. A rise of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index could result from dire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', is a value derived by merging air temperature with the humidity to convey how the climate feels. This impact is subjective, influenced by the person's physical activity and individual heat perception, affected by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ic differences. Awareness of direct sun exposure is crucial as it has the potential to heighten the weather's effects, pushing up the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are quite important for babies and toddlers. Young children are generally more endangered than adults, as they usually less sweat. And also, due to lar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and higher heat production as a result of their activity.
Perspiring is the body's way of cooling down, particularly by allowing sweat to evaporate and take the heat with it. When relative humidity increases, the body's capacity to evaporate heat decreases, leading to a heightened sense of warmth. Excessive heat that's not properly managed leads to increased body temperatures and resultant health issues.

Humidity

In Hodges, the average relative humidity in August is 75%.

Rainfall

In Hodges, in August, during 20.1 rainfall days, 3.82" (97m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Hodges, there are 187 rainfall days, and 45.98" (1168m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Hodges, snow does not fall in April through October.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August in Hodges is 13h and 24min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:03 am and sunset at 7:52 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 6:24 am and sunset at 7:18 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 10.1h.

UV index

In August, the average daily maximum UV index in Hodges is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 6 during August translates into the following recommendations:
Endorse precautions and be consistent with sun safety guidelines. Preventing sunburn is paramount. Avoid direct sunlight between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Keep in mind that shade structures may not provide complete protection. A hat with a broad brim is indispensable, filtering out up to half of UV rays.
